ARTISTS' AND WRITERS' PERSPECTIVES
This book offers you the opportunity to discover the perspectives of painters and writers who have dedicated a part of their work to the theme of vineyards and wine. The greatest writers such as Balzac, Giono, Bossuet, Montaigne, Baudelaire, Hugo, Zola, Colette, Daudet, as well as the greatest painters like Picasso, Van Gogh, Toulouse-Lautrec, Velasquez have addressed themes such as grape harvesting, festive meals, and wine-soaked gatherings.
